STATEMENT OF WORK
1) BACKGROUND INFORMATION
The Flow Cytometry Section (FCS) provides the Division of Intramural Research (DIR) with
application-specific flow cytometric technologies, including instrumentation and multi-color
analysis. In addition, the FCS provides training, consultation, method development, and analysis
for experiments involving flow cytometry. This mission is accomplished through the efforts of
staff with extensive flow cytometry experience and with the use of cell sorters and analyzers.
Major goals are to provide access to state-of-the-art technologies, to help design and run
experiments, to facilitate data interpretation, and to provide results that are of consistent high
quality.
The FCS has multiple high-end Becton, Dickinson, and Company (BD) cytometers, high
throughput samplers (HTS), flow supply systems, and lasers already in use for imaging various
samples. These instruments are constantly in use on a daily basis and if it were put out of action
due to lack of maintenance or mechanical failure the ability of the investigators in the DIR to
conduct their research would be severely handicapped. It is for this reason that a Service
Agreement is essential these BD instruments.

Becton, Dickinson, and Company (BD) cytometers and lasers provide flow cytometric analysis
and sorting for all the Intramural program within the National Institute of Allergy and Infectious
Diseases (NIAID). Each instrument supports multiple experiments each day, and each
instrument if fully utilized. The research projects supported are complex and varied. As such,
the facility is required to maintain equipment that provides for a wide range of applications that
includes the ability to modify and adapt capabilities as new applications are developed. Due to
heavy use, the instruments must be repaired, recalibrated, and returned to operation as soon as
possible after failure. To assure optimal performance and reliability, the instruments require
maintenance by specially trained and experienced service engineers. If the systems were put
out of action due to the lack of maintenance or mechanical failure, the ability of the investigators
in the DIR to conduct their research would be severely handicapped. Therefore, the FCS
requires a 12-month service agreement starting in July 2026 to ensure that an instrument is
back to service as quickly as possible after a failure or necessary maintenance.
3) SCOPE
The contractor shall perform preventive, remedial maintenance and repair services to
maintain the BD instruments in good working condition in accordance with the equipment
manufacturer's specifications.

5) CONTRACTOR REQUIREMENTS
The Contractor shall provide services coverage for the BD instruments referenced above that
includes the following:
• Two (2) Preventive Maintenance (PM) inspections to be performed during a twelve-
month period, including 2 PM Kits.
• Software revisions released during the Agreement term.
• Unlimited service visits, by guaranteed OEM technicians, Monday-Friday, excluding
holidays.
• Unlimited telephone support for instruments, reagents and applications will be provided
at no additional charge.
• Every reasonable effort will be made to respond to a request for emergency on-site
service (Monday through Friday, excluding holidays) within 48 hours.
• OEM parts, labor and travel for remedial repair.
• Update installations at the time of scheduled preventive maintenance visits
.
